What is a lectionary?
Generally, a lectionary is a list of scriptural texts (called
"lections") recommended for use in worship or study on a
particular day. Christian lectionaries are usually built around
the Church Year, but they are sometimes centered on the
secular calendar (as with programs that guide a person through
reading the Bible in a year). Christian lectionaries generally include a reading from the Hebrew Bible, a Psalm, a reading from the Epistles, and a Gospel reading.
